an artificial reservoir for storing liquids; especially an underground tank for storing rainwater
a tank that holds the water used to flush a toilet 同义词:water tank,
a sac or cavity containing fluid especially lymph or cerebrospinal fluid 同义词:cisterna,
A cistern (Middle English cisterne, from Latin cisterna, from cista, "box," from Greek κ?στη, kistê, "basket")Webster's Ninth New Collegiate Dictionary, 1990 edition, etymology of "cistern". is a waterproof receptacle for holding liquids, usually water.
